Matt Sinclair’s Ultimate Chicken Parmigiana Slider

Masterchef 2016 runner-up Matt Sinclair has created what could be the world’s tastiest chicken parma.

The ultimate parma is an upgrade on the iconic Aussie pub classic, featuring premium ingredients including buttermilk fried chicken, streaky bacon, Monterey Jack cheese and chipotle peppers.
